$9 Million Funds for Meebo, the Instant Messaging Alternative

Meebo is regarded as the most powerful alternative for the instant messaging networks because it allows you to chat on multiple connections using a simple webpage. Meebo provides you quick access to Google Talk, Yahoo Messenger, Windows Live Messenger and other Jabber servers so it is quite useful because you can chat on multiple networks without installing several applications. At this time, Meebo is one of the largest communities on the internet because it represents the perfect alternative for students or employees that cannot access messaging clients from school or office.

Because the
service is free for everyone, many users asked themselves how a solution with such popularity can survive without money, advertisements or sponsors. You must know that Meebo received a $3.5 million funding from Sequoia in December 2005, so the service is not quite a waste of time.

"Meebo, a site where users can access all of their instant messaging applications in a single browser window, is announcing a $9 million Series B round of financing from Draper Fisher Jurvetson this evening, adding to the $3.5 million they raised from Sequoia in December 2005. As part of the round, Tim Draper is joining Meebo's board of directors," TechCrunch reported.

"Meebo is a website for instant messaging from absolutely anywhere. Whether you're at home, on campus, at work, or traveling foreign lands, hop over to Meebo on any computer to access all of your buddies (on AIM, Yahoo!, MSN, Google Talk, ICQ and Jabber) and chat with them, no downloads or installs required, for free! Meebo launched in September 2005 and received funding from Sequoia Capital in December 2005. Today, our users exchange over 70 million instant messages daily. We (the Meebo team) are just a fun bunch of people trying to bring IM to the web!" the company describes the service.

I'm not sure if these investments can help Meebo, but the service is continuously growing because you can find some available jobs on the official website for Software Engineer (Front-End), Software Engineer (Back-End), Visual Designer, System Administrator and Information Engineer.
